Thanks to the news from @WisdomPikachu and @DigitalChat, more information about Xiaomi’s latest flagship model, the Redmi K60 Ultra, has gradually surfaced.
The Redmi K60 Ultra will allegedly come with a MediaTek Dimensity 9200+ processor and will support the new generation of 210W fast charging technology. The @WisdomPikachu also said that the device will be announced next month and will be available in the second half of this year with “more performance than all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 models on the market”.
These claims were also confirmed by @DigitalGossipStation, who also said that the Redmi K60 Ultra will be launched in July this year. Of course, we can’t rule out the possibility that the Redmi K60 Ultra will debut on the 10th anniversary of the Redmi brand.
The CPU consists of one Cortex X3 super core, three Cortex A715 large cores and four Cortex A510 small cores, with CPU main frequencies of 3.35GHz, 3.0GHz and 2.0GHz respectively.

Compared with its predecessor CPU, the CPU of the 9200+ is 10% more powerful in large cores, 11% more powerful in small cores, 10% more performance in single cores, 5% more performance in multi-core, and the Rabbit V9 score exceeds 1.36 million. MediaTek’s 9200+ mobile platform will make the Redmi K60 Ultra the “most powerful” Redmi phone ever, and when combined with Redmi’s self-developed “Rampage Tuning” feature, it is expected to break the 1.4 million mark in combined scores.
The CPU is also equipped with immortalis-G715 MC11 GPU, which has a 17% increase in main frequency and a 10% increase in performance compared to its predecessor.
The Redmi K60 Ultra is expected to have a 1.5K narrow bezel AMOLED straight screen, with a screen supplier from Huaxing, after cutting out the plastic screen mount. It is expected to have a metal frame, a 50MP rear camera with a large base lens, and a built-in 5000mAh battery.
